What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der defined by persistent pat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. While its symptoms are typically acknowledged in childhood, they can continue into the adult years and manifest differently. Adults with ADHD may have problem with organization, time management, and maintaining focus, which can significantly affect their careers, relationships, and lives.

1. Clinical InterviewsGoal: Gather comprehensive information about the person's history and present symptoms.Includes: Personal history, family history, and results of symptoms on daily life.2. Self-Report QuestionnairesGoal: Evaluate symptoms based on the person's self-perception.Examples:Adult Online ADHD Test UK Self-Report Scale (ASRS)Conners Adult ADHD Rating Scales (CAARS)3. Behavioral Rating ScalesGoal: Collect data on habits from numerous viewpoints.Includes: Input from relative, partners, or coworkers.4. Cognitive AssessmentsObjective: Assess cognitive performance, including executive functions (planning, arranging, and handling time).Approaches: Neuropsychological tests that determine attention, memory, and analytical abilities.5. Physical ExaminationObjective: Rule out any medical problems that could contribute to symptoms.Includes: Blood tests or other appropriate health indicators.Summary of the ADHD Assessment ProcessStepDescription1. Treatment PlanningTeam up on a strategy that may consist of treatment, medication, and coping techniques.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: How long does an ADHD assessment take?
A: The duration can vary however usually varies from one to numerous hours, frequently spread throughout numerous sessions.
Q2: Can adults have ADHD if they were never ever diagnosed as children?
A: Yes, many adults with ADHD might not have actually been diagnosed in childhood due to different factors such as lack of awareness or misconception of symptoms.
Q3: What should I anticipate throughout my assessment?
A: Expect to discuss your symptoms, complete questionnaires, and collect input from people who understand you. You may also undergo cognitive evaluations.
Q4: How can I prepare for an ADHD assessment?
A: Reflect on your symptoms and their effects on daily life, note particular examples, and think about how ADHD may have impacted your life traditionally.
Q5: What are the next steps after getting a medical diagnosis?
A: If identified with ADHD, your healthcare company will go over treatment choices customized to you, which may include medication, therapy, or lifestyle changes.
